ESPN.com Monday, August 22, 2005 Editor's note: ESPN.com's Mel Kiper Jr. begins his look at the most important players on each Division I-A team with his lists of the five most important players on five teams from the Big Ten (schools listed in alphabetical order). Northwestern Wildcats 1. Brett Basanez, QB, sr. -- Has started since his freshman year and should be primed for a good senior season if he can stay healthy.
